What type of player (or buyer) are you and which table football tables should you be looking at?


Buying for young children / family use
When buying a table football table for young children your only real considerations are price, durability and possibly storage space. It is probably also a good idea to look at the height of the table football table you are buying to make sure your children can reach comfortably – around 80cm is about right. We recommend spending less than £150 until your children are old enough to need something more solid or become more serious about the sport.

Adult Beginner / Leisure use
Your table football table should be simple, solid and durable with no extras adding to the cost. Just a basic good quality table that you can learn the game on before deciding to step up to the next level.  We recommend spending between £150 and £300.

Bar, pub, leisure club, hotel
The table football table that you need here really depends on what you are going to use it for, where it’s going to be and who will be using it. Please feel free to contact us to discuss your options. Here are a few points to consider.

If you want customers to have to pay to play:
You need a coin operated table football table if you want to make money from having table football on your premises. You options include the legendary Bonzini B60 – the biggest selling coin operated table since table football began (be warned it’s not cheap!). Coin Operated table football tables can also have a glass top to stop damage to the players of removal of the balls.

Leisure club or sports bar for free customer use:
Again this will depend mainly on your budget and also on the finish of the table (so that it matches any current furnishings that you have. Please feel free to call us to talk through your options. The main thing is that the table will stand up to the public use (and abuse!). Look for a strong and sturdy cabinet (at least 25mm thick) and strong solid legs.

Outdoor Use
These table football tables are weatherproof and rust proof and are generally very heavy duty.
